Definition

Noun: A type of fish loaf, specifically one made using flaked salmon as the primary ingredient. It is a baked dish where the salmon is combined with other ingredients like breadcrumbs, eggs, and seasonings, formed into a loaf shape, and then cooked.

Variants and Related Words
  • Fish loaf (n): The general category of baked loaves made from flaked fish, which includes salmon loaf.
  • Salmon cake (n): A related dish where seasoned, flaked salmon is formed into individual patties and pan-fried, rather than baked as a single loaf.
